Transaction 373468394d4a2047e0503868b95a0e2084e685812523674d7fba0b34afdc09f0

2 Input
2 Outputs
  • 373468394d4a2047e0503868b95a0e2084e685812523674d7fba0b34afdc09f0:0
  • value  200100000
    address  2N5u7VbmYvHxsBDf9un3wivA2nC5xWfxm8j
  • 373468394d4a2047e0503868b95a0e2084e685812523674d7fba0b34afdc09f0:1
  • value  11673767
    address  n4pxdE3vE9YohYmQsef1Q1i4SQSYjTCGfo